What are the OSHA standards in a paper mill?

U.S. OSHA standards for paper mill operations are in 29 CFR 1910, the General Industry Standards.


What is the objective of financial controller in a company?

Accurately report the financial results of the company's operations in acordance with generally accepted standards. Produce reports for management which help then analyze and better understand what is going on in the company operations. Help produce company budgets and report spending and revenue against the budgeted numbers.


Who sets accounting standards for the government?

If the entity is a state or local governmental unit, it is subject to the reporting standards and requirements of the Government Accounting Standards Board.
